[PATCH 2/2] habanalabs: improve security in Debug IOCTL

2019-08-06 Thread Omer Shpigelman
This patch improves the security in the Debug IOCTL.
It adds checks that:
- The register index value is in the allowed range for all opcodes.
- The event types number is in the allowed range in SPMU enable.
- The events number is in the allowed range in SPMU disable.

Signed-off-by: Omer Shpigelman 
---
 drivers/misc/habanalabs/goya/goya_coresight.c | 72 ---
 1 file changed, 63 insertions(+), 9 deletions(-)
